Sprinkle baking soda over the top of the sofa, reaching as many upholstered areas as possible. Leave the baking soda sitting on the fabric overnight and vacuum the following day with an upholstery attachment. The baking soda removes any odd smells plaguing the fabric.
Pull the separate sections apart and measure each piece separately, according to the vendor's instructions. Write down the measurements on a sheet of paper. Order custom-made slipcovers for each piece of the sectional sofa, using the measurements for each piece. Make sure that you can purchase extra fabric that you may need in the future for replacements or small repairs.
Slide the slipcover over the largest piece of the sectional sofa. Tuck the ends under the sofa and smooth down the surface with your hands. Adjust the fit as needed, making sure that you completely cover the top and sides. Repeat the process with each additional sofa piece.
Decorate the sofa with throw pillows and throw blankets that match the decor or style of your room. Arrange a few pillows at each end and drape a comfortable blanket across the back.
Move the sofa pieces to different areas of the room. Use an end piece as a chaise lounge under one window and use the opposite end as a bench style couch for the center of the room.
